evangeli“Evangeli Gaudium” –  The Joy of The Gospel.  Pope Francis has written this 85 page document to all the faithful expressing a special attention to the needs of the poor.  This has been a key theme of his Papacy and it is a timely reminder that Christ’s own birth, which we celebrate in a few weeks, was one of poverty.  You can read and download the full document here.

St. NicholasThe fact that this saint is so associated with Santa Claus makes him so attractive to people of all ages. If we look at the name: Saint Nicholas we already see a Latin connection between the word ‘Sancta’ meaning ‘holy’ and our Christmas word ‘Santa’. In fact, the Dutch legend of Sinterklaas has the name quite exact; Sint meaning saint and klass short for Niklaas or Nicholas. -So he is caught out, this guy is one and the same! Archbishop Charles BrownVisit from Papal Nuncio, Archbishop Charles Brown

Breaking News and a date to add to your Diary!!!.  His Excellency, The Papal Nuncio, Most Rev Charles John Brown is coming to our Parish on Sunday the 8th of December to celebrate Mass at 10:30 a.m.  It will be followed by refreshments in the Parish Room.  He was ordained a priest for the Archdiocese of New York by Cardinal John Joseph O’Connor on 13 May 1989 in St. Patrick’s Cathedral, New York. From 1989 to 1994 he worked as an assistant Priest in the Bronx.  In 2000 after having ministered for the Congregation for the Doctrine of the Faith he became a chaplain for His Holiness on May 6th, 2000. Brown was named Titular Archbishop of Aquileia and nuncio to Ireland on 26 November 2011 and was ordained to the episcopate by Pope Benedict XVI on 6 January 2012.  It is a great honour and privilege to have him visiting our Parish and we hope all who can attend will come to celebrate with us on this special day.

Thank YouA very special word of thanks to all who helped contribute to last week’s collection of which 50% went to help the people in war torn Syria and the other half to provide food and shelter to those displaced by the Typhoon in the Philippines.  Thanks to your generosity a total of €7,540.00 was raised and will go to aid those suffering in these two countries.  Please keep united with us and the whole Church in prayer for those affected by wars and natural disasters.
